§ 11-51-61 — Proceedings for Sale of Land for Payment of Taxes - Decree of Sale

Alabama·Title 11 Counties and Municipal Corporations·Ch. 51 Taxation·Art. 1 Property Taxes·Div. 2 Optional Method for Levy and Collection of Property Taxes
The decree for tax sales rendered by the probate judge under the provisions of law in regard to state and county taxes shall embrace taxes due to such municipalities, showing the aggregate amount due to the state, county, and municipality and showing what amount is for the municipality and the tax year of the municipality for which the same is due it.

Legislative History

(Acts 1931, No. 300, p. 337; Acts 1939, No. 57, p. 67; Code 1940, T. 37, §718.)
